Abstract

Five novel nickel(II) complexes have been successfully synthesized with a heterocyclic ligand, Opdac, [Ni(Opdac) 2]Cl 2 ( 1), [Ni(Opdac) 2(CH 3OH) 2]Br 2(CH 3OH) 2 ( 2), [Ni(Opdac) 2]I 2 ( 3), [Ni(Opdac) 2NO 3]NO 3 ( 4) and [Ni(Opdac) 2ClO 4]ClO 4 ( 5) where Opdac = 4-(1-H-1,3-benzimidazole-2-yl)-1,5-dimethyl-2-phenyl-1-2-dihydro-3-H-pyrazol-3-one. All the complexes were characterized by elemental analysis, molar conductivity, CHN analysis, magnetic susceptibility measurements, spectroscopic studies and TG/DTA methods. In all the complexes, Opdac acts as a bidentate ligand coordinating to Ni(II) ion via the benzimidazole imine nitrogen and the pyrazolone oxygen atoms. The complexes 1 and 3 have a tetrahedral geometry while 2, 4 and 5 have an octahedral geometry around the Ni(II) center.
